The Paris metropolitan area, home to over 12 million residents, presents a unique urban civil engineering environment. With the implementation of the strict Zone à Faibles Émissions (ZFE-m) across the Boulevard Périphérique and inner-ring communes, contractors face unparalleled operational constraints. Road construction and maintenance machinery operating in this territory must adhere to European Stage V emission norms, low noise signature thresholds for night-shift paving, and minimal footprints for narrow historic thoroughfares.
The ongoing expansion of the Grand Paris Express network demands robust road resurfacing, heavy-duty logistics access corridor reinforcement, and specialized trenching backfill compaction. Equipment deployed serving Paris factories must provide seamless interoperability with cold in-place asphalt recycling (CIPR) technologies to minimize material haulage across congested arterial networks such as the A86 duplex and the A1 highway link.

HEM Group was founded in 1998 by a group of distinguished professors from Chang'an University and seasoned road building industry experts, initially operating as Xi'an Hongda Communications Technology Co., Ltd. It stands as the earliest high-tech enterprise dedicated to independent research and design of road construction equipment in China.
Since its inception, the company has adhered strictly to high-tech research guidance aimed at creating an international brand for construction machinery. Our continuous R&D investment has yielded numerous invention patents in mechanical dynamics, engine power matching, hydraulic transmission technology, and digital electronic control. In 2006, HEM Group was officially recognized as a "High-tech Enterprise" by the Shaanxi Provincial Department of Science and Technology.
In 2017, to streamline international trade and direct global client support, the dedicated export organization—HME TOP Machinery Equipment Co., Ltd.—was established. Today, our 5,000 m² modern manufacturing base delivers an annual capacity exceeding 5,000 units, backing a complete end-to-end chain of road maintenance machinery and earthmoving heavy equipment.
